WebOct 14, 2024 · 1. Call 1-800-829-1040 between the hours of 7:00 AM – 7:00 PM local time. 2. Press “1” for English or “2” for Spanish. 3. Press “2” for “answers about your personal … WebHe should try to reach Taxpayer Advocate Service toll-free at 1-877-777-4778 M - F 7am - 7pm local time and speak with a representative.
